Understanding Panel Bending Technology

Panel bending is revolutionizing the way we approach metal fabrication. This technology enables the efficient shaping of metal panels through a quick and precise process, leading to increased productivity and reduced labor costs. Traditional bending methods often involve complicated setups and lengthy operational times, but panel bending offers a streamlined alternative. By using advanced machinery designed for high-speed production, manufacturers can create complex shapes without sacrificing quality or efficiency.

Key Advantages of Effortless Panel Bending

One of the primary benefits of panel bending technology is its effortless setup. Operators can quickly program bending machines via user-friendly interfaces, eliminating the need for extensive training. This swift setup process allows for rapid transitions between different bending tasks, making it easier to adapt to varying production demands. Consequently, businesses can minimize downtime and maximize throughput, enhancing overall operational efficiency.Moreover, panel bending machines are designed with precision in mind. Equipped with advanced sensors and software, these machines ensure accurate bends, reducing the chances of errors that can lead to material waste. This precision not only results in cost savings but also helps maintain consistent quality across all products.

Operational Efficiency and Speed

Time is money in the manufacturing sector, and panel bending significantly cuts down operational time. With the ability to process multiple bends in a single setup, these machines can rapidly produce intricate products that would traditionally take much longer to fabricate. This speed advantage is crucial in today’s fast-paced market, where customer demands are constantly evolving.Additionally, many panel bending machines are designed for flexibility, allowing operators to quickly switch between various materials, such as aluminum and stainless steel. This adaptability means that manufacturers can easily cater to diverse client needs without the constant need for reconfiguration.

Reducing Labor Costs and Training Time

Manual bending often requires skilled laborers who are trained in complex setups and operations. In contrast, panel bending systems simplify the process, enabling less experienced operators to handle tasks efficiently. The intuitive software interfaces and automated features reduce the learning curve, thus circumventing the need for extensive training sessions. This ultimately lowers labor costs and allows businesses to allocate their workforce more effectively.In addition, the reduction in human error further enhances labor efficiency. With precise machinery handling the bending process, the potential for mistakes decreases, leading to lower production costs and better resource utilization.

Implementation in Modern Manufacturing

As industries continue to lean towards automation and technology integration, panel bending is becoming a staple in modern manufacturing. Companies that adopt this technology can expect not only a significant boost in productivity but also a solid competitive advantage. The seamless integration of panel bending into existing workflows can yield a considerable return on investment, making it an attractive option for manufacturers of all sizes.Many businesses are already reaping the benefits of switching to effortless panel bending. With faster setups and operations, they can respond to customer needs more effectively and maintain a steady output.
